Description

In this typed letter, dated February 19, 1936, Clarence L. Scammon of the Commonwealth Fund writes to Dr. Robert B. Ray at the Tulane University Graduate School of Medicine in New Orleans to inform Dr. Ray that they are enclosing the stipend for the first month of his fellowship at Tulane.
